Brazil's Cane Supply System: Agreement Parties & Exporters – Major Entities

The Brazil's sugar provision system involves several critical actors. On the agreement side, large agricultural businesses such as Tereos and Adecoagro function as key parties, obtaining raw sugar cane supplies from various smaller producers. At the same time, global vendors like Cargill and Wilmar manage the shipping of sugar to customers internationally, playing a vital part in the overall commercial context. These relationships are complicated and often shaped by periodic factors, price variations, and state regulations.
